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Error en DELETE

Estas en el tema de Error en DELETE en el foro de Mysql en Foros del Web. Hola, estoy haciendo una aplicacion de inscipciones. El administrador de las inscripciones muestra una tabla en la cual aparece un boton en cada fila para ...
  #1 (permalink)  
Antiguo 16/04/2011, 15:00
 
Fecha de Ingreso: junio-2004
Mensajes: 51
Antigüedad: 20 años, 4 meses
Puntos: 0
Error en DELETE

Hola,

estoy haciendo una aplicacion de inscipciones. El administrador de las inscripciones muestra una tabla en la cual aparece un boton en cada fila para eliminar ese registro.

el codigo de eliminación es este:

Código PHP:
$idborrar $_POST[id];
echo 
$idborrar;
$consulta2 "DELETE * FROM dosmilonce WHERE id = $idborrar";
$resultado2 mysql_query($consulta2) or die (mysql_error());
echo 
"Se ha eliminado al usuario ".$_POST['nombre']; 
el error que me devuelve es: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'* FROM dosmilonce WHERE id = 2' at line 1

el id lo coge bien, asi que no se cual puede ser el problema, ya que es una consulta bastante sencilla y me estoy volviendo loco.

Gracias, Fran
  #2 (permalink)  
Antiguo 16/04/2011, 15:07
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 17 años
Puntos: 2658
Respuesta: Error en DELETE

Código MySQL:
Ver original
  1. DELETE FROM dosmilonce WHERE id = $idborrar
Sin asterisco...

Cualquier duda es mejor siempre acudir primero al manual de referencia: 13.2.1. Sintaxis de DELETE
Especialmente cuando andas saltando entre lenguajes distintos (PHP y SQL)
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#3 (permalink)  
Antiguo 16/04/2011, 16:11
 
Fecha de Ingreso: junio-2004
Mensajes: 51
Antigüedad: 20 años, 4 meses
Puntos: 0
Respuesta: Error en DELETE

Joder, que error mas tonto. Estaba yo con el SELECT....

Muchas gracias

Etiquetas: delete
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:45.